Output 31f85ef7051b3be3fb4337d1592a60ecc982911e82db0dfdee40d03e5581740f:54

value
67108864
script pubkey
OP_0 OP_PUSHBYTES_20 e36a0b55dae25608ab6e556cf7d8059214dd48cf
address
bc1qud4qk4w6uftq32mw24k00kq9jg2d6jx0gh3dn2
transaction
31f85ef7051b3be3fb4337d1592a60ecc982911e82db0dfdee40d03e5581740f
spent
true